Abstract
With the recent signing of Washington accord, India demonstrated the commitment to move to the outcome based education (OBE). This paper elaborates the process and the assessment methodology by adopting various parameters, tools and rubrics for successful paradigm shift towards OBE for the existing engineering programs. This paper also discusses the challenges to be addressed by various stakeholders.
